Carbon steel elbows are metal fittings that change the direction of the pipeline on carbon steel pipes. The connection methods are threaded and welded. According to the angle, there are three most commonly used ones: 45° and 90°180°. In addition, it also includes other abnormal angle elbows such as 60° according to engineering needs. The elbow materials are cast iron, stainless steel, alloy steel, malleable cast iron, carbon steel, non-ferrous metals and plastics. The ways to connect with the pipe are: direct welding (the most common way) flange connection, hot melt connection, electrofusion connection, threaded connection and socket connection. According to the production process, it can be divided into: welding elbow, stamping elbow, push elbow, casting elbow, etc. Other names: 90 degree elbow, right angle bend, love and bend, etc.
Variety classification
Carbon steel elbows are first classified according to their radius of curvature, which can be divided into long radius elbows and short radius elbows. Long-radius elbow refers to its radius of curvature equal to 1.5 times the outer diameter of the tube, that is, R=1.5D. A short radius elbow means that its radius of curvature is equal to the outer diameter of the pipe, that is, R=1.0D. (D is the diameter of the elbow, R is the radius of curvature. D can also be expressed in multiples.) If divided by pressure level, there are about seventeen types, which are the same as the American pipe standards, including: Sch5s, Sch10s, Sch10 , Sch20, Sch30, Sch40s, STD, Sch40, Sch60, Sch80s, XS; Sch80, Sch100, Sch120, Sch140, Sch160, XXS, among which the most commonly used are STD and XS. According to the angle of the elbow, there are 45° elbow, 90° elbow and 180° elbow. The implementation standards are GB/T12459-2005, GB/T13401-2005, GB/T10752-1995, HG/T21635-1987, D-GD0219, etc.
The advantages of the carbon steel elbow manufacturing process are mainly manifested in the following aspects
(1) No tube blank is required as raw material, which can save the cost of tube making equipment and molds, and can obtain arbitrarily large diameter and relatively thin carbon steel elbows.
(2) The blank is a flat plate or a developable curved surface, so the blanking is simple, the accuracy is easy to ensure, and the assembly and welding are convenient.
(3) Due to the above two reasons, the manufacturing cycle can be shortened, and the production cost is greatly reduced. Because it does not require any special equipment, it is especially suitable for on-site processing of large carbon steel elbows.
(4) Carbon steel elbows are suitable for pipeline series in oil, natural gas, chemical, hydropower, construction and boiler industries.
